"Stomach stapling" generally refers to procedures that are no longer performed (even though some of the present procedures do involve staples/sutures on the stomach). If you're interested in weight loss surgery, the four procedures currently most widely performed are the Roux-en-Y (gastric bypass), Duodenal Switch (DS), adjustable gastric banding (Lap Band, Realize Band), and Vertical Sleeve Gastrectomy (VSG).
Wiring your mouth shut would probably work temporarily, but I would imagine that as soon as you get it unwired and start eating normally again, you'd regain the weight. Further, it is VERY possible to stay or get heavier even on only liquids - after all, think about how many calories are in milkshakes, regular sodas, juices, etc.
